    Well, we missed margarita Wednesdays ($2.99), but we had a very good lunch here anyway. They were still quite busy when we stopped by at 1ish. The restaurant isn't in the Boynton mall, but in a strip of places just south. There's parking right out front. They delivered warm chips and two types of salsa -- one hot -- to the table. These were good. My husband got the taco salad with ground beef. He liked it -- ate every bit! I had their ceviche appetizer. It's shrimp, tomatoes, onions, and cilantro in a citrus marinade. Plus sliced fresh avocado on top. I'm used to it a bit sweeter than acidic (sone places add ketchup), so I added a packet of Splenda. It was delicious. We are definitely coming back to try their margaritas and also some of the other more traditional food items in the menu.

    Lunch today while running errands in Boynton and found this restaurant on our bookmarked places. It is on BOYTON MALL ROAD, NOT INSIDE THE MALL. So this was a Thursday and of course the $2.99 House Margarita Special is only offered on Wednesdays. (Next time we'll plan our arrival to take advantage!) Parking spaces are available in front but they are parallel spots. Service was very good and our orders were delivered in a reasonable amount of time. My Taco Salad with ground beef and the Green House dressing was delicious and satisfying. My wife liked her Shrimp Ceviche enough to get past the spice level. She had requested Mild.

    I was going to give them a 3 rating but when we left, I noticed how poorly lit the parking lot was so I'm giving them a 2 instead. I found the food to be very bland and this was even after putting salsa on it. The spicy salsa I didn't find to be that spicy and both the spicy and non-spicy sauces didn't taste well to put it bluntly. Further, we were there for the $2.99 margarita special and for $.50 more you can get a flavored margarita. I had two mango margaritas and it seemed like there was hardly any alcohol in them. I felt just sober after my second drink as I did prior to my first drink. My taco combo main course also was nothing special and again bland, even after putting salsa on it. Service was adequate nothing special In all honesty I would not go back nor could I recommend it to someone else.

    I came here with my partner for lunch on a Saturday afternoon. The place was extremely cold for some reason to the point i had to go get a jacket. It was clean and the waitress was nice. She seemed to be the only server and it took 20 mins after seating to even get chips and salsa. My partner ordered the fish in garlic sauce. It had so much potential but the fillet was very bland. The sauce was good though. I ordered ropa viejo and it was also just ok. The sauce was watery and it gave "it was sitting in a freezer for a while ". We liked the sides of rice, beans and plantain. I personally wouldn't come back though
